RICHMOND, Va. —Light rain is falling across parts of downtown Richmond with more moderate amounts east of I-95.
Showers will continue off and on through the day, mixed with some dry breaks, but skies will stay cloudy and breezy statewide.
The highest rain totals, stronger winds, and a risk of coastal flooding will be found near the Chesapeake Bay and Atlantic shore. A Coastal Flood Warning is in effect for areas adjacent to Chesapeake Bay, as well as rivers leading into the Bay (Rappahannock, James and York).
